foodcoop-adam/foodsoft

View on GitHub
app/controllers/invites_controller.rb

Summary

Maintainability
A
1 hr
Test Coverage

Method create has 26 lines of code (exceeds 25 allowed). Consider refactoring.
Open

  def create
    authenticate_membership_or_admin params[:invite][:group_id]
    # admins may send invites to multiple email addresses at once
    emails = params[:invite][:email]
    emails = emails.split(/\s*(,|\s)\s*/).reject{|e| e.blank? or e==','} if @current_user.role_admin?
Severity: Minor
Found in app/controllers/invites_controller.rb - About 1 hr to fix

    There are no issues that match your filters.

    Category
    Status